How Exclusive Is Scottie Scheffler’s Putter? TaylorMade Insider Opens Up
Summary
The putter used by golfer Scottie Scheffler, who is ranked as the world's top player, is a TaylorMade Spider Tour X L-Neck putter that is widely available to the public. Although this putter is not highly specialized or exclusive, Scheffler has achieved significant success with it, including winning major tournaments. TaylorMade's Adrian Rietveld notes that Scheffler's talent enables him to perform well even with this standard equipment.Key Facts
- Scottie Scheffler is currently the world's top-ranked golfer.
- He has won 13 PGA Tour events, including three major championships and an Olympic gold medal with his current putter.
- Scheffler switched from a Scotty Cameron blade putter to a TaylorMade spider putter.
- Adrian Rietveld from TaylorMade assisted Scheffler with the transition to the new putter.
- Despite expectations, Scheffler's putter is a standard model, the TaylorMade Spider Tour X L-Neck, available for about $350.
- Scheffler had not been professionally fitted for a putter before choosing this one.
- Rietveld describes how Scheffler's natural talent allows him to excel with this common putter.
